Bears attack Bulldogs in preseason contest
Detrick Powell started the scoring for Leroy on the first drive of the game on a 3-yard touchdown run. Patrick Rivers ran the ball in on the extra point, for the two-point conversion, giving Leroy the early 8-0 lead. With 2:16 remaining in the first quarter, Kyle Pennington completed a touchdown pass for 31 yards. The two-point attempt was snubbed for the Bulldogs.
With Washington County threatening before heading to the locker room, Leroy's Brandon "Brodie" Jones came away with a huge interception near the Bulldog 38-yard line to send it to the half. Within the first few minutes of the third quarter, Johnny Williams broke loose for a 48yard touchdown run giving Leroy the 20-6 lead. With 6:55 in the third, Kyle Pennington once again connected with his receiver for a touchdown, making this a 2012 ballgame. After a 35-yard kickoff return from Grant Brown on the ensuing kickoff, Ronald Bracey added a huge score for Leroy on a 19-yard touchdown run making it 26-12. Leroy would add three more touchdowns from that point on, including a returned fumble for 81 yards and a score by Courtney Kimbrough. Clint Moseley added the final touchdown for Leroy on a QB sneak for 6 yards making it 46-12 in favor of the Bears. "We played hard for four quarters, just like they did," said senior lineman Bryan Lankford. "We have got to get to work and get ready for Jackson now," said Leroy Head Coach Danny Powell. "Jackson is well-coached by John Blackmon. He has done a wonderful job over there. They are a very good club. "Moseley did a wonderful job against Chatom. We have several different weapons and some very skilled players."
"We still have a long way to go," said quarterback Clint Moseley. "There is going to be a lot of people in Jackson Thursday night. It is a huge game and I am excited about being at quarterback."
